概述
在使用iTerm2时,使用ssh root@127.0.0.1链接远程服务器,一段时间内无操作,服务会自动关闭,需要重新链接服务器
原因
- 服务器断开链接
- iTerm2自动断开链接
解决方案
客户端(iTerm2 配置修改)
sudo vim /etc/ssh/ssh_config
文件尾端添加:
ServerAliveInterval 60 ###数值是秒
服务端
sudo vim /etc/ssh/sshd_config
文件尾端添加:
ClientAliveInterval 600 ###数值是秒 可以随意设置
ClientAliveCountMax 10 ###如果发现客户端没有响应,则判断一次超时,参数设置是允许超时次数
操作提示
- 编辑文件后注意保存
- 需要退出iTerm2,并重启iTerm2
- 可以忽略服务端操作,仅修改iTerm2配置,并重启即可